    Lee makes a 125 grain round nose that has worked easy in every 9mm I have tried it in.

    shootingstar,
    I answered your message and can help you out there. For the 40-cal mould, I highly recommend the standard Lee 40-175-TC (I use the standard-lube-groove model) in a 6-cavity. It's a great design. Feeds like butter and matches the original profile of the FMJ-TC bullets exactly. Mine weight 180grs out of my WW + 2% tin alloy.

    For the 38, I'd recommend you watch for or contact Dutch4122. He honchoed a group buy for a plain base version of the Lyman 358156 boolit that came out fantastic. I bought one, and regret it. Should have bought two! The boolits drop with hardly any tapping, and there's few rejects.

    For the 30-cal., you're gonna have to look around. There are SO many good boolits, you probably need to give us more information (like what guns and calibers you're loading for and what their throat/bore measurements are). I currently have a Saeco 315, and I'm working on group buy versions of the Lyman 311407 and 311041... All have fantastic reputations as shooters, but there are still more - 311299 comes to mind for a heavy boolit, and I believe it's also made in a .314" size for large-bore rifles like 303s...
